Understanding Real, Though Rare, Risks
ItS crucial to acknowledge that no medical intervention is entirely without risk. Robust surveillance systems,like those employed by the CDC and WHO,are designed to detect and quantify these rare events. For example, anaphylaxis, a severe allergic reaction, occurs at a rate of approximately 1.3 per million doses administered. Similarly, studies have identified a link between the MMR vaccine and febrile seizures, occurring in roughly 333 per million doses (see: https://www.sciencedirect.com/science/article/pii/S0264410X14006367). Nationwide Registry Studies: denmark’s extensive nationwide registry studies have similarly found no link between vaccines and either Type 1 diabetes or autism (https://www.nejm.org/doi/full/10.1056/NEJMoa021134). Further Confirmation: studies published in the Journal of Pediatrics* and Germany’s nationally representative KiGGS study (including a notable cohort of unvaccinated children – 94 in total) corroborate these findings (https://www.jpeds.com/article/S0022-3476(13)00144-3/fulltext00144-3/fulltext) and https://pmc.ncbi.nlm.nih.gov/articles/PMC3057555/).
The flaws of Flawed Analyses
The recent focus on an unpublished analysis presented to a Senate committee exemplifies the dangers of prioritizing speculation over established science. The methodology of this analysis was fundamentally flawed,exhibiting a critical detection bias – confusing healthcare visits for diagnoses.Any trained epidemiologist would readily identify this error.
It’s a concerning double standard to embrace a study when it aligns with pre-existing beliefs while dismissing it when it doesn’t. This selective interpretation is not scientific inquiry; it’s confirmation bias.
